Furthermore, How do you know if a call dropped? A dropped call is a call that instantly hangs up the phone connection, meaning: no active call-timer should be running. If the call goes silent, but the timer is still running, this is a One/No Way Audio issue and whenever the call does terminate it is usually the other party hanging up.

Moreover, Why is my iPhone randomly ending call? The most likely reason that your iPhone is dropping calls consistently is that you are getting a poor signal. You might be in an area with low coverage. It also could be that there are some temporary problems that the carrier is having.

What is the iPhone call history limit?

iPhone call history is limited to the last 100 entries. Older entries are hidden but they might be available through a 3rd-party app. Apple says the limit is the last 100 calls for all apple phones. They do suggest two options: your phone carrier may have an 18 mo history which you can get from them.

Why are my calls getting automatically disconnected after a few seconds?

This issue appears mostly because the session was not actually established and is in most cases network(NAT) related. … You need to first disable SIP ALG under your router configuration, if you do not know how to do it, you will need to contact your Network service provider / administrator for assistance.

Why does my phone cut off after 15 minutes?

If you’re having problems with SIP and calls are cutting off after 15 minutes, it could be a problem with firewall configuration. To fix it, check the following: Consistent NAT (Network Address Translation) is enabled. Single Sign On Authentication Packet is turned off or disabled.

How do you ignore a call on iPhone without blocking?

  1. Press the volume up or volume down button once.
  2. Alternately, you can press the Side button (or Sleep/Wake button) once.
  3. After you silence a call it will continue to ring (silently) and you can answer if you change your mind.

Can you see call history with a contact on iPhone?

When tapping the info button next to a contact in the Recents, the details for that specific call will appear. If there were multiple calls with this specific contact before another call, the history of those sequential calls will appear when tapping the info button.
